Overview Ultrawash Mouth Rinse

OraCleanse mouthwash offers analgesic properties, effectively managing pain, discomfort, and inflammation within the oral cavity, including the gums and throat. It soothes swelling and accelerates tissue repair. Always adhere to your physician's instructions regarding dosage and frequency; exceeding the prescribed regimen won't enhance efficacy and may heighten the risk of adverse reactions. Generally well-tolerated, minor side effects like temporary burning or skin irritation may occur at the application site. These typically subside spontaneously; however, persistent or worsening symptoms warrant immediate medical attention. Your doctor can offer strategies for mitigation. Prior to use, disclose all current and recent medications to your physician, including those for similar conditions or other health issues.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ek medical counsel before initiating treatment to ensure safety.

How to use Ultrawash Mouth Rinse:

Always examine the product label prior to use. Administer the prescribed amount of mouthwash, as directed by your physician, into your mouth. Gently swish the mouthwash for 30 seconds to one minute, then expectorate. Ingestion is strictly prohibited. Refrain from consuming food, beverages, or tobacco products for a minimum of 30 minutes following rinsing.

How Ultrawash Mouth Rinse works:

OraCleanse, a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ory mouthwash, inhibits the production of inflammatory mediators responsible for oral pain and swelling.

What if you forget to take Ultrawash Mouth Rinse :

Should you forget a dose of Ultrawash Mouth Rinse, use it as soon as you remember. If your next dose is imminent, however, omit the missed dose and resume your usual routine. Never take a double dose.
